How much does it cost to rent a home in Highland Park?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Highland Park 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,338 | $900 | $3,500 |
Highland Park 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,377 | $850 | $3,250 |
Highland Park 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,628 | $1,150 | $3,250 |
Highland Park 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,350 | $700 | $8,000 |
Highland Park 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,300 | $3,300 | $3,300 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Highland Park
What type of rentals are currently available in Highland Park?
There are currently 413 Apartments for Rent in Highland Park, MI with pricing that ranges from $410 to $4,340. There are also 136 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Highland Park ranging from $500 to $8,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Highland Park?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Highland Park ranges from $500 to $8,000 with an average monthly rent of $2,003.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Highland Park?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Highland Park range from $525 to $3,250,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$850 to $3,250.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,150 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,975.
